Domestic Violence Project

Community Outreach Worker

General  Responsibilities:

Under the supervision of the VLAS Development Director with input from the unit Managing Attorney, the outreach worker will provide community education, build relationships with partner agencies and funding entities, and help ensure that the maximum number possible of domestic violence victims receive legal assistance from VLAS.

Duties: the outreach worker will, as requested by her or his supervisor:

1. Complete required training;

2. Create and implement a comprehensive outreach and referral plan to reach as many DV victims as possible in the VLAS service area by working through partner agencies;

3. Identify and coordinate with community partner agencies and community leaders to assist with outreach, education and referrals;

4. Identify hard to reach populations for outreach and education activities;

5. Arrange and present at community education and partner events;

6. Assist in drafting of marketing materials and evaluation instruments;

7. Perform such other tasks and may be assigned by the Development Director or unit Managing Attorney.

 

Employment Classification: Full-time employee exempt from the provisions of the Fair Labor Standards Act.

Qualifications

• Knowledge of domestic violence causes, effects, laws and services

• Experience with community outreach, organizing and/or public campaigns.

• Experience and skill in group presentations and training

• Strong oral and written communication skills, ability to express ideas clearly and succinctly.

• Strong analytical skills, highly organized with attention to detail

• Willingness to travel and work evenings and weekends

• Good computer skills and proficient with Microsoft Excel, Word, and PowerPoint

• Bachelor’s degree preferred
